Telecom real estate
Our experience in the telecoms sector dates back over 25 years
We have been involved in the Telecoms industry right from the beginning.
When the roll out of mobile base stations started in earnest, we started acquisition work for Orange and T-Mobile (now EE), quickly followed by Vodafone and O2 and finally Three when it was launched at the end of the decade and we are still here now acquiring rights for 5G rollout.
We currently comprehensively manage what is probably one of the largest real estate portfolios in the UK – the Mobile Broadband Network Limited (MBNL) portfolio of some 30,000 mobile base stations. MBNL operates the combined network for EE and Three, providing coverage to 99% of the UK’s population.
From our beginnings in business rates and acquisition, we have developed a long list of bespoke services we offer to Operator clients.
